Bluetooth V4.0 EDR & BLE 模块详解:HM-12规格与应用

版权申诉
0 下载量 45 浏览量 更新于2024-06-26 收藏 24KB DOCX 举报
"该文档是关于蓝牙规格V4.0增强数据率(EDR)和低功耗(BLE)技术的资料整理,包含了HM-12蓝牙模块的产品参数和使用注意事项。" 蓝牙规格V4.0结合了两种不同的技术:增强数据率(EDR)和低功耗(BLE),旨在提供高效、节能的无线通信解决方案。EDR技术提高了蓝牙的传输速率,而BLE技术则专注于降低设备的能耗,使其适用于物联网(IoT)设备和可穿戴设备。 HM-12蓝牙模块是一款符合Bluetooth Specification V4.0 EDR和BLE标准的设备。它具有512字节的串行缓冲区,支持SPP(串行端口协议)的最大收发距离为30米,而BLE模式下可达60米。在传输速率上,SPP大约能实现40%的串口效率,而BLE则约为30%。安全方面,该模块提供了认证和加密功能,确保数据传输的安全性。 此外,HM-12支持EDR服务如L2CAP(逻辑链路控制和适配协议)、SDP(服务发现协议)、RFCOMM(蓝牙串口协议)以及SPP。对于BLE服务,它包含了ATT(属性协议)和GATT(通用属性配置文件),以及LE Service:0xFFE0和Char:0xFFE1这两个特定的蓝牙低功耗服务。 模块的物理特性包括工作温度范围为-5到+80摄氏度,尺寸为26.9mm x 13mm x 2.2mm,以及27KB的容量。电源电压为2.5-3.7V,且支持SPP和BLE协议。模块的管脚配置包括UART接口(TX, RX, CTS, RTS),以及多个悬空(NC)和GPIO(PIO0-PIO11)管脚,可用于按键和LED控制以及数字输入/输出。 在使用HM-12模块时,需要注意与单片机的连接,特别是电压匹配问题。如果与5V单片机连接,需要在RX引脚与单片机TX引脚之间添加电阻和分压电阻以保护模块。在布局设计上,由于蓝牙模块工作在2.4G无线频段,应避免任何可能干扰无线收发的因素,比如金属材料的使用,以确保无线通信的稳定性和可靠性。 总结来说,此文档详细介绍了蓝牙V4.0 EDR和BLE技术的特点,以及HM-12模块的具体参数、功能和应用注意事项,为开发基于蓝牙的无线系统提供了重要的参考信息。